Output 94d799ee185609079c51b90e25ccfa1adc82d475cdf9e3e4b5a09ae5bfc93109:1

value
34357177
script pubkey
OP_HASH160 OP_PUSHBYTES_20 345647596f9e86111c150e0bf0fcaafae9efcc24 OP_EQUAL
address
MCftj9x6nU7KPn93PTePNPqijPkNJjTMqb
transaction
94d799ee185609079c51b90e25ccfa1adc82d475cdf9e3e4b5a09ae5bfc93109
spent
true